If you bring up the pantone color palette and select the pantone color they have given you, it should give you the equivelent hex value. You can then use the hex value either directly in your page or you can see the rgb value.

This may be too late for you but I do know how to do this. These instructions are for version 5.5 but 6.0 and 7.0 should be similar.

Click once on the foreground color on your tools bar. That should bring up the color palette. Click on the custom button and the palette becomes a Pantone color selector. You can either pull the slider down or use the right and left arrows or type in the pantone number until you find your color. When you' ve done that, just click on the picker button on the right and the palette will switch back to the RGB, CMYK, HUV version.
